Transaction fc3560da760cb84546f8e721fcc886c4c56f8e0232f67992e7e69dfd928760f7
1 Input
1 Output
-
fc3560da760cb84546f8e721fcc886c4c56f8e0232f67992e7e69dfd928760f7:0
- value
- 791474
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f3717ee6dea9fd61401f509cd0d724cccf37065 OP_EQUAL
- address
- 3K84z9Q2ujkMtwxEaABGdm7zdLAbzq3xHq